前言 本文介绍的是利用Python实现的一个小工具,用于分析Git commit log,获得Git Project每个成员的简单行为数据。 Warning:代码量不能代表程序员能力水平! 启动参数 共5个。
exec_git Git Log命令:
git -C {} log --since={} --until={} --pretty=tformat:%ae --shortstat --no-merges -- {} > {}
填入参数,调用系统命令'os.system()',输出结果至本地临时文件。读取至内存,简单的String Array。 parse Git Log输出有3种格式,对应3种正则表达式。 REPATTERN_FULL = r"s(d+)D+(d+)D+(d+)D+n" REPATTERN_INSERT_ONLY = r"s(d+)D+(d+)sinsertionD+n" REPATTERN_DELETE_ONLY = r"s(d+)D+(d+)sdeletionD+n" 遍历得到的数据,首先构造一个以Author为Key,分析结果为Value的字典。 分析结果构造一个元祖,包括:
save_csv 简单省略。 示例代码:
#!/usr/local/bin/python3
# -*- coding: utf-8 -*-
'''Analyse git branch commit log,for every version,every person.'''
import os
import sys
import re
import csv
GIT_LOG = r'git -C {} log --since={} --until={} --pretty=tformat:%ae --shortstat --no-merges -- {} > {}'
REPATTERN_FULL = r"s(d+)D+(d+)D+(d+)D+n"
REPATTERN_INSERT_ONLY = r"s(d+)D+(d+)sinsertionD+n"
REPATTERN_DELETE_ONLY = r"s(d+)D+(d+)sdeletionD+n"
CSV_FILE_HEADER = ["Author","Commit","Insert","Delete","Loc"]
def exec_git(repo,since,until,subdir):
'''Execute git log commant,return string array.'''
logfile = os.path.join(os.getcwd(),'gitstats.txt')
git_log_command = GIT_LOG.format(repo,subdir,logfile)
os.system(git_log_command)
lines = None
with open(logfile,'r',encoding='utf-8') as logfilehandler:
lines = logfilehandler.readlines()
return lines
def save_csv(stats,csvfile):
'''save stats data to csv file.'''
with open(csvfile,'w',encoding='utf-8') as csvfilehandler:
writer = csv.writer(csvfilehandler)
writer.writerow(CSV_FILE_HEADER)
for author,stat in stats.items():
writer.writerow([author,stat[0],stat[1],stat[2],stat[3]])
def parse(lines):
'''Analyse git log and sort to csv file.'''
prog_full = re.compile(REPATTERN_FULL)
prog_insert_only = re.compile(REPATTERN_INSERT_ONLY)
prog_delete_only = re.compile(REPATTERN_DELETE_ONLY)
stats = {}
for i in range(0,len(lines),3):
author = lines[i]
#empty = lines[i+1]
info = lines[i+2]
#change = 0
insert,delete = int(0),int(0)
result = prog_full.search(info)
if result:
#change = result[0]
insert = int(result.group(2))
delete = int(result.group(3))
else:
result = prog_insert_only.search(info)
if result:
#change = result[0]
insert = int(result.group(2))
delete = int(0)
else:
result = prog_delete_only.search(info)
if result:
#change = result[0]
insert = int(0)
delete = int(result.group(2))
else:
print('Regular expression fail!')
return
loc = insert - delete
stat = stats.get(author)
if stat is None:
stats[author] = [1,insert,delete,loc]
else:
stat[0] += 1
stat[1] += insert
stat[2] += delete
stat[3] += loc
return stats
if __name__ == "__main__":
print('gitstats begin')
if len(sys.argv) != 6:
print('Invalid argv parameters.')
exit(0)
REPO = os.path.join(os.getcwd(),sys.argv[1])
SINCE = sys.argv[2]
UNTIL = sys.argv[3]
SUB_DIR = sys.argv[4]
CSV_FILE = os.path.join(os.getcwd(),sys.argv[5])
LINES = exec_git(REPO,SINCE,UNTIL,SUB_DIR)
assert LINES is not None
STATS = parse(LINES)
save_csv(STATS,CSV_FILE)
print('gitstats done')
